Coach Izzy


Biography

Coach Izzy is a Pain Therapist, Strength Coach, Author, Speaker, and Educator with nearly two decades of experience. He is the president and founder of Integrated Healing and Strength Systems, Inc. and responsible for helping hundreds of individuals eliminate pain and regain an active lifestyle.

He has also introduced hundreds of fitness professionals to the joys of proper kettlebell and Olympic Weightlifting.

His work has been featured multiple times in Shape Magazine, Exhilarate Magazine, Dive News Network, and countless websites. He was also a regular guest in the TV Show “Fitness, Health, and Healing.”

You can find many of his works beautifully mingling his approaches by browsing on amazon.com. Coach Izzy has always been a master of integration and time has always proven his methodologies – even when strongly opposed at first – were on the right track.

Coach Izzy is an avid outdoor enthusiast and scuba diver. He lives on Bainbridge Island, WA with his wife Catherine, and their pets. He feels blessed to be involved in a field where he can restore hope and make a big difference in people’s lives. He is always striving to learn more and deliver better services and his happy clients are testament to his dedication.
